#1d96c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d96c9 is composed of 11.4% red, 58.8%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 197.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 45.1%. #1d96c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#002d93.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1d96c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d96c9 has RGB values of R:29, G:150,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1939145.

Shades and Tints of #1d96c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090c is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d96c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7679 is the less saturated color, while #02a1e4 is the most saturated one.
